Как уменьшить многословность регистрации доступа к оружию - PullRequest
0 голосов
/ 10 декабря 2018

Я обновился до Gunicorn 19.9 с 19.4, и это примерно вдвое увеличило количество выходов в Heroku.Я считаю, что это все из-за журналов доступа, которые по какой-то причине сейчас включены.Я хочу отключить это.

Вот как выглядят эти подробные сообщения:

Dec 10 10:34:46 ballprice app/web.5: (IP address) - - [10/Dec/2018:16:34:46 +0000] "GET /us/c/reptiles/pythons/ball-pythons/home HTTP/1.1" 200 11271 "-" "Mozilla/5.0 (Linux; Android 8.0.0; SM-N950U)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/71.0.3578.83 Mobile Safari/537.36" 

Heroku утверждает, что получает протоколирование через stdout / stderr, но похоже на вариант по умолчаниюдля accesslog должно быть None:

http://docs.gunicorn.org/en/latest/settings.html#logging

Я также попытался http://docs.gunicorn.org/en/latest/settings.html#disable-redirect-access-to-syslog, думая, что, возможно, запись в журнал отправлялась в syslog, но это тоже не удаляло ее.

Я запускаю gunicorn следующим образом:

web: bin/start-pgbouncer-stunnel newrelic-admin run-program gunicorn mysite.wsgi --pythonpath mysite --timeout 30 --max-requests 10000 --disable-redirect-access-to-syslog

Спасибо!

...